AJ61 CDO is a 2012 Chevrolet Aveo in Red with a 1,248c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.2%.
Across all 2012 Chevrolet Aveo models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.7% with a typical mileage of 51,380 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Chevrolet Aveo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 4,014 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AJ61 CDO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chevrolet Aveo typ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 14 years old, this Chevrolet Aveo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
